#dfc082 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dfc082 is composed of 87.5% red, 75.3%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.9% magenta, 41.7%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 40 degrees, a saturation of 59.2% and a lightness of 69.2%. #dfc082 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bf8105.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#dfc082 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dfc082 has RGB values of R:223, G:192,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.14, Y:0.42,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14663810.

Shades and Tints of #dfc082
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100c04 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#dfc082
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5b2ac is the less saturated color, while #fdca64 is the most saturated one.
